Clinical Description
Rheumatoid Arthritis Overview
Rheumatoid arthritis (RA) is a systemic autoimmune disease that primarily affects the joints but can also have extra-articular manifestations, including lung involvement. It is characterized by symmetrical joint inflammation, leading to pain, swelling, and potential joint destruction over time. The disease can also affect other organs, including the lungs, heart, and skin.
Rheumatoid Lung Disease
Rheumatoid lung disease encompasses a range of pulmonary complications associated with rheumatoid arthritis. These can include:
- Interstitial Lung Disease (ILD): This is the most common pulmonary complication in RA, characterized by inflammation and scarring of lung tissue, leading to progressive dyspnea and reduced lung function.
- Pleural Disease: Patients may develop pleuritis or pleural effusions, which can cause chest pain and difficulty breathing.
- Nodules: Rheumatoid nodules can form in the lungs, similar to those found subcutaneously.
- Bronchiectasis: This condition involves the abnormal dilation of the bronchi, leading to chronic cough and sputum production.

Clinical Presentation
Overview of Rheumatoid Lung Disease
Rheumatoid lung disease encompasses a range of pulmonary complications that can arise in patients with rheumatoid arthritis. These complications may include interstitial lung disease, pleural effusions, pulmonary nodules, and bronchiectasis. The presence of lung disease can significantly impact the overall health and quality of life of patients with RA.
Signs and Symptoms
Patients with rheumatoid lung disease may exhibit a variety of respiratory and systemic symptoms, including:
- Respiratory Symptoms:
- Dyspnea: Shortness of breath, which may be progressive and can occur at rest or with exertion.
- Cough: A persistent dry cough is common, which may worsen over time.
- Wheezing: This may occur due to bronchial involvement or obstruction.
-
Chest Pain: Discomfort or pain in the chest, which may be pleuritic in nature.
-
Systemic Symptoms:
- Fatigue: A common complaint among patients with RA and associated lung disease.
- Fever: Low-grade fever may be present, particularly during exacerbations.
- Weight Loss: Unintentional weight loss can occur due to chronic illness.
Physical Examination Findings
During a physical examination, healthcare providers may observe:
- Decreased Breath Sounds: Particularly in areas affected by pleural effusion or lung consolidation.
- Crackles: Fine or coarse crackles may be heard upon auscultation, indicating interstitial lung disease.
- Clubbing: Digital clubbing may be present in chronic lung disease, although it is less common in RA-related lung disease.
- Signs of Arthritis: Joint swelling, tenderness, and deformities, particularly in the left hip, may be noted.
Patient Characteristics
Demographics
- Age: Rheumatoid arthritis typically presents in middle-aged adults, with a peak onset between 30 and 60 years of age.
- Gender: Women are more frequently affected by rheumatoid arthritis than men, with a ratio of approximately 3:1.
Comorbidities
Patients with rheumatoid lung disease often have additional health issues, including:
- Cardiovascular Disease: Increased risk of heart disease due to systemic inflammation.
- Other Autoimmune Disorders: Co-occurrence with conditions such as Sjögren's syndrome or systemic lupus erythematosus.
- Chronic Obstructive Pulmonary Disease (COPD): Patients may have a history of smoking or other risk factors contributing to lung disease.
Disease Duration and Severity
- Duration of RA: Patients with longer-standing rheumatoid arthritis are at higher risk for developing lung complications.
- Severity of Joint Involvement: More severe joint disease may correlate with increased risk of pulmonary manifestations.

Diagnostic Criteria for Rheumatoid Lung Disease
The diagnosis of rheumatoid lung disease typically involves a combination of clinical evaluation, imaging studies, and laboratory tests:
1. Clinical Evaluation
- History of Rheumatoid Arthritis: A confirmed diagnosis of RA is essential, often supported by the presence of symptoms such as joint pain, swelling, and morning stiffness.
- Respiratory Symptoms: Patients may report symptoms such as chronic cough, dyspnea (shortness of breath), or chest pain, which can indicate lung involvement.
2. Imaging Studies
- Chest X-ray: Initial imaging may reveal abnormalities such as nodules, pleural effusions, or signs of ILD.
- High-Resolution Computed Tomography (HRCT): This imaging modality provides a more detailed view of lung structures and is crucial for identifying specific patterns of lung disease associated with RA, such as ground-glass opacities or reticular patterns.
3. Pulmonary Function Tests (PFTs)
- These tests assess lung function and can help identify restrictive or obstructive patterns indicative of lung disease. A decrease in forced vital capacity (FVC) or diffusing capacity for carbon monoxide (DLCO) may suggest interstitial lung disease.
4. Laboratory Tests
- Rheumatoid Factor (RF) and Anti-Citrullinated Protein Antibodies (ACPA): Positive results for these antibodies support the diagnosis of rheumatoid arthritis and may correlate with lung involvement.
- Inflammatory Markers: Elevated levels of markers such as C-reactive protein (CRP) or erythrocyte sedimentation rate (ESR) may indicate active inflammation.
5. Histopathological Examination
- In some cases, a lung biopsy may be performed to confirm the diagnosis of specific lung pathology associated with rheumatoid arthritis, particularly if the imaging findings are inconclusive.
Specific Considerations for M05.152
When diagnosing M05.152, it is crucial to confirm both the presence of rheumatoid lung disease and the involvement of the left hip due to rheumatoid arthritis. This may involve:
- Joint Examination: Assessing the left hip for signs of inflammation, such as swelling, tenderness, and reduced range of motion.
- Imaging of the Hip: X-rays or MRI may be used to evaluate joint damage or erosions characteristic of rheumatoid arthritis.

Standard Treatment Approaches
1. Disease-Modifying Antirheumatic Drugs (DMARDs)
DMARDs are the cornerstone of treatment for rheumatoid arthritis and are crucial in managing associated lung disease. Commonly used DMARDs include:
- Methotrexate: Often the first-line treatment, methotrexate can help reduce inflammation and slow disease progression.
- Sulfasalazine: This medication may be used in patients who do not respond adequately to methotrexate.
- Leflunomide: Another option for patients who cannot tolerate methotrexate.
2. Biologic Agents
For patients with moderate to severe RA or those who do not respond to traditional DMARDs, biologic agents may be indicated. These include:
- Tumor Necrosis Factor (TNF) Inhibitors: Such as infliximab (Inflectra, Remicade) and adalimumab (Humira), which can help reduce inflammation and improve lung function.
- Interleukin-6 (IL-6) Inhibitors: Tocilizumab (Actemra) is effective in managing both RA and associated lung complications.
- Other Biologics: Agents targeting different pathways, such as rituximab (Rituxan) and abatacept (Orencia), may also be considered based on individual patient needs.
3. Corticosteroids
Corticosteroids, such as prednisone, are often used to manage acute exacerbations of lung disease. They can help reduce inflammation quickly but should be used judiciously due to potential side effects, especially with long-term use.
4. Symptomatic Treatment
Managing symptoms is crucial for improving the quality of life in patients with rheumatoid lung disease. This may include:
- Bronchodilators: To relieve symptoms of bronchospasm.
- Oxygen Therapy: For patients with significant hypoxemia.
- Pulmonary Rehabilitation: A structured program that includes exercise training, education, and support to improve lung function and overall well-being.
5. Monitoring and Follow-Up
Regular monitoring of lung function through pulmonary function tests (PFTs) is essential for assessing the progression of lung disease. Additionally, imaging studies, such as chest X-rays or CT scans, may be necessary to evaluate lung involvement and guide treatment adjustments.
6. Lifestyle Modifications
Encouraging patients to adopt healthy lifestyle changes can also play a significant role in managing both RA and lung disease. This includes:
- Smoking Cessation: Smoking can exacerbate lung disease and should be strongly discouraged.
- Regular Exercise: Tailored exercise programs can help maintain lung function and overall health.
- Nutritional Support: A balanced diet can support immune function and overall health.
